I don't think you need to download and install every one of those. They might be included with the Cyrus IMAP package, but I'm not sure. Go ahead with the instructions and see how it goes.
By the way, you don't have to use Cyrus IMAP. Cyrus IMAP and Cyrus SASL are both standalone products. You can use any IMAP or POP server that you want, but its probably easier to use whatever the howto's author is using (at least until you get it up and working, and then you can switch if you want).
